We want to put a dehumidifier in our unit, probably just in the Master Bedroom bath. something we can leave running
while we're gone for the next few months, without worrying about emptying a holding tank. I noticed that the ones at Home Depot, mention 30 and 40 liter capacity. I hoped to find something that could just drain down the shower drain.

Several people in our building have them, but they aren't in residence at the moment to ask them.

GW: on most units you can remove the reservoir and connect a hose on the small pipe that the water drips out of. Make sure to put a little clamp to hold the hose on to this pipe!!! Also check if there is a trip switch that the reservoir pushes against when in place? You will have to keep that engaged with something.
Don't be shocked too much when you see your hydro bill when you return tho, these things suck a bit of juice and will run non stop!

You could also use a plug in timer that you can set to run as long as you want in a 24 hour period (half hour increments). Make sure it's rated above the amp draw of the dehumidifier. I think Home Depot sells a G.E timer good for 15 amps.
